Transaction 50bceffb53bfd72de790cdc3c7de08d5aedf7b4dc128fb030b84fef7b3916bf9

1 Input
2 Outputs
  • 50bceffb53bfd72de790cdc3c7de08d5aedf7b4dc128fb030b84fef7b3916bf9:0
  • value  432626398
    address  14rXWvWyTyaqeBrAiCfYzYJjtT8qqRGu8n
  • 50bceffb53bfd72de790cdc3c7de08d5aedf7b4dc128fb030b84fef7b3916bf9:1
  • value  2000000
    address  1JcUvHwJkrdsdoWyBDNgwqY6sFKR1KvDHZ